1.6 Changes in the Purpose of Collecting and Using Personal Information Please understand that as our business develops, we may adjust and change QuickPera's functions and services. In principle, when new functions or services are related to the current functions or services, the personal information collected and used will have a direct or reasonable connection with the original processing purpose. In scenarios not directly or reasonably related to the original processing purpose, we will inform you again and obtain your consent to collect and use your personal information.

2.2 Change of Operating Entity

With the continuous development of our business, we may undergo mergers, acquisitions, or asset transfers, and your personal information may be transferred as a result. In the event of such changes, we will require the successor to protect your personal information according to legal requirements and security standards not lower than those stipulated in this privacy policy. If the successor changes the original processing purpose or method, we will require them to obtain your authorization and consent again.

2.3 Cessation of Operations

If we cease to operate products or services, we will promptly stop collecting your personal information. We will notify you individually or inform you through announcements and delete or anonymize personal information related to the discontinued products or services that we hold.

3.1 Account Deactivation

You can apply to deactivate your account via the QuickPera mobile client by going to "My" > "Settings" > "Deactivate Account." Before deactivating your account, we will verify your personal identity, security status, and device information. You acknowledge and understand that deactivating an account is irreversible. Once your account is deactivated, we will delete or anonymize your relevant information unless otherwise stipulated by laws and regulations.
